Subterranean termites are the most destructive pests of wood in the United States.

Termites cause more than $2 Billion in damages each year. That's more property damage than that caused by fire and wind storms combined.

Termite Treatment Programs

Remedial Termite Treatment
RID ALL offers post construction termite treatments for every situation. Whole structure protection is usually the best approach when termites are concerned, but zone or spot treatment can prove effective in some instances. RID ALL usually treats existing termite infestations with the least toxic, but most effective means practical. “Most effective” sometimes leads to the introduction of a non-repellant synthetic termiticide such as Termidor™ or Phantom™ to ensure the infestation does not reoccur. The interior of the home is almost always treated with organic products, but the exterior treatment may be performed with a synthetic material to assure success.

Whole Structure Protection
This type of treatment gives an envelope of protection to the whole home. When we treat an entire home, a guarantee is usually made against further infestation and the customer has an option of renewing coverage for a number of years after the treatment. Slab homes receive exterior treatment with either a non-repellant termiticide or a baiting system utilizing an IGR (Insect Growth Regulator) active ingredient. The interior of a slab home receives a wall void treatment around plumbing penetrations with borate foam. Special attention is given to plumbing areas around bath tubs and showers since many termite problems occur here.

Crawl Space or Pier and Beam homes receive termite treatment where the termites originate. If the crawl space gives adequate clearance, then either borate or non-repellant termiticide treatment is rendered in the crawl space at the problem area as well as other vulnerable points. We recommend treating all the wooden members in the crawl space with Bora Care™ to further protect against termites, wood destroying beetles, and wood decaying fungi.

Zone or Spot Treatment
This type of treatment addresses only the problem area. A spot is defined as the area within two feet of the actual termite infestation. We usually treat the area within ten feet of all sides of the infestation with non-repellant termiticide, borate foam, or termiticide foam. Spot treatments usually do not carry the same guarantee as whole structure treatments, but a thirty day to one year guarantee is typically offered on the treated area.

Since termites can cause significant damage to a structure after relatively short infestation times, RID ALL will often suggest a compromise to the fully organic treatment. Termites are not difficult to kill and all organic products we use eliminate them quite handily, but they are very persistent insects. Most organic products we use do not remain stable in the soil long enough to adequately protect our customers structures, so we provide the least toxic control methods practical. We use the synthetics sparingly and blend them into the natural approach to offer not only the most effective termite protection available, but we offer control programs that blend into your environment.

Pre-construction Services
RID ALL offers traditional preconstruction termite treatments with a natural twist. Preconstruction termite treatments are performed before a home or building is completed. Traditional methods involve spraying chemicals on the soil to create a barrier before the concrete slab is poured. Instead of old fashioned soil treatments with toxic chemicals, we provide an accepted and approved treatment using Borate materials.

After the slab is poured and the walls and roof are covering the structure, we treat the wooden support members with Bora Care™ to prevent termite infestation. The product absorbs into the wood and actually becomes a property of the lumber. The structure is built around the treated lumber and the property is protected without a traditional chemical soil treatment. The borate products give years longer protection for the home than the chemical alternatives, costs about the same, and provide a certain peace of mind over chemical soil treatments.
